摘要:

随着通信业的高速发展,移动通信用户的主要感知从原先对覆盖范围的要求转移到对信号稳定的要求。引发用户感知下降的原因大部分是基站天线的工程参数出现异常。为了提高基站工程参数管理的效率,并对工程参数进行集中统计、分析、趋势预测,以更好地服务于运营商的网络优化工作,提出了一套配合基站工程参数采集终端使用的移动通信基站参数管理系统。该管理系统经试运行取得了预期的效果,对运营商的网络优化工作提供了有力的帮助。

Abstract:

With the rapid development of the telecom industry, the main perception from mobile communication users in the original coverage transferred to the signal stability. Most of the reasons for the decline of the user perception are due to the abnormality of the engineering parameters of the base station antenna. In order to improve the efficiency of the management of base station engineering parameters, and engineering parameters for centralized statistics, analysis, trend prediction, and better serving the network optimization of the mobile operators, a set of management system was proposed for mobile communication base station parameters cooperating to the engineering parameters collection terminal of the base station. Through trial operation, the management system has achieved the expected effect, and it can provide a powerful help for mobile operators in network optimization.
